WPM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2018 in Review

327 of the 4,374 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Wheaton Precious Metals (WPM) for Q3 2018, worth a combined $4.35B — down 18% from $5.3B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 40 funds closed out of WPM and 36 opened new positions — a net loss of 4 holders — while 123 trimmed existing stakes and 101 added.

The largest buyer was Ruffer LLP, adding an estimated $79.4M. The largest seller was Carmignac Gestion, cutting an estimated $56M.
